To protect yourself, wear long pants and socks … WebMYTH 3 – Ticks can be suffocated so they drop off on their own. Incorrect. A tick breathes through openings in its sides called ‘spiracles’. It only breathes around 1 – 15 times per hour. Using solutions such as alcohol, aftershave, oils / butter, paraffin, petroleum jelly or nail polish, to try to suffocate a tick, may cause it to regurgitate (vomit) saliva and gut … taxis olx bucaramanga https://msledd.com

WebDec 30, 2024 · Ticks fall off on their own after sucking blood for 3 to 6 days. After the tick comes off, a little red bump may be seen. The red bump or spot is the body's response to the tick's saliva (spit). While it's sucking blood, some of its spit gets mixed in. Causes of Tick Bites. WebUnlike hard ticks, which stay attached for days, soft ticks only feed for 15 to 30 minutes before they drop off. Their bites are often painless, so you may get bitten and not realize it.

Southern tick-associated rash … taxis matehualaWebOct 5, 2024 · Ticks feed on blood by latching onto a host and feeding until they're swollen to many times their normal size. Ticks can pick up bacteria from a host, such as a deer, and then spread the bacteria to another host, such as a human. The spread of the bacteria from the tick to the host probably occurs about 24 hours after the tick has begun feeding. taxis menuWebThe tick’s life stage: Larvae, nymphs, and adults have different time frames in which they feed and stay attached.
